Dutch startup founded by siblings picks €2M to build next-gen headless commerce

The pandemic has propelled the emergence of quick commerce, in which companies offer to deliver food and other carefully curated essentials in 15 minutes or less.

Quick commerce companies deliver straight from smaller format dark stores strategically positioned in high-density locations, unlike traditional merchants that distribute from out-of-town stores or warehouses.

Consequently, headless e-commerce solution Instant Commerce which aims to redefine how eCommerce brands build and manage headless storefronts has secured a €2M pre-seed round led by firstminute capital (London VC which also invested in cheq and Tenyks recently). The round was also supported by the founders of Storyblok, Wandera, Snyk, and Supercell.

The Dutch startup plans to use the funds to expand its team, develop its platform, and raise brand awareness across Europe.

Quick commerce on rise

Instant Commerce is a frontend as a service solution that allows any eCommerce firm to establish a high-end headless storefront. It was founded in 2022 by brothers Sam and Coen Van Hees along with their friend Doeke Leeuwis.

Because Instant Commerce is a ‘no-code’ platform, business owners don’t require any technical knowledge or a development team to create an online presence. Instant Commerce’s platform uses APIs to interact with a variety of platforms, including Shopify, Storyblok, Algolia, and others.

Instant Commerce has landed over 30 big clients since its inception in the year 2022, including Bols, ID&T, Ekster, and Yaya.

Making things effortless

The startup has reduced the time it takes to construct a webshop from four months to less than a week, and it is expected to be a key platform in facilitating the next wave of e-commerce growth, allowing businesses of all sizes to meet today’s customer expectations and compete with the biggest brands.

Coen Van Hees, founder and CEO of Instant Commerce, said, “Consumer expectations of the functionality and services online retailers should offer has grown exponentially over the past few years. This race to make online storefronts more engaging has led to much higher costs, strained infrastructure and a severe drain on resources. For many companies it’s simply too costly to compete. This is the problem Instant Commerce solves. By making building and maintaining a headless storefront as simple and cost-effective as possible, we give power back to business owners.There’s a huge demand for our platform. In only four short months we’ve secured more than 30 clients including big names like Bols and ID&T. Now, with the support of Firstminute Capital and our Angel Investors we’ll be able to rapidly expand our team, platform and start preparations for entering more international markets.”

Sam Endacott at firstminute capital, said, “We believe the future of web development and e-commerce is headless and have had a front-row seat in this category with our investments in Storyblok and Nuxt. However, the missing link has been a software layer to co-ordinate the ecosystem of APIs from the front-end that can be used by both non-technical users and developers. The Instant Commerce team have experienced this pain-point directly having built a highly successful e-commerce Agency before working with major global brands. Their first product – a no-code solution to help e-commerce teams go headless without technical expertise – is just the first step in what we think can be a major platform in facilitating the next wave of e-commerce growth.”
